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6839504 234871 07629 370861663 123009
631519906 518881785
631519906 518881785
2827 63681 106 545 42
All about undefined
Interested in learning more?
631519906 518881785
2827 63681 106 545 42
See more
82870454 91 5598800211
210 81341028034 9653472
See more
78 366134121 61603
4352 98341415 1267534826
See more